How to play Massachusetts on ukulele
To play Massachusetts on ukulele, strum the everywhere 4/4: d – d u – u d –. The groove sits around 78 bpm, a relaxed pace. On this page the song is in G major. I rate the chords skilled, a fair middle ground. Soft, even downstrokes suit this gentle sixties ballad.
5 ukulele chords used in "Massachusetts" by Bee Gees: Am, C, D, D7 and G
